San Diego, specifically
- Downtown, Balboa Park, La Jolla: Strong throughout, including the zoo grounds and the cliffs at Torrey Pines.
- Crossing into Tijuana: This one catches people out. A US plan does not cover Mexico. Walk across at San Ysidro and your data stops, even though you are still on the trolley line you started on. You need a Mexico plan for that side, or you are on airport-Wi-Fi-and-hope.
- Beaches and the Coaster: Coverage runs the length of the coast rail line up to Oceanside, and on the Coronado ferry.
- Anza-Borrego and the backcountry: An hour east and the desert parks lose it. Julian and the mountain roads are patchy between towns.
Fifty states, one border
The plan works across the US, so LA and Vegas are covered. Mexico is a separate country and a separate plan.

Arriving in San Diego
Airport Wi-Fi at SAN
San Diego International gives two-hour free sessions, and you can start a new one when it expires.

Frequently asked questions
Where to buy a SIM card in San Diego?
SAN has carrier kiosks, and there are AT&T, T-Mobile and Verizon stores in Fashion Valley and Westfield UTC. Retail beats airport pricing. An eSIM saves the stop.
Will a store ask for ID for a prepaid SIM?
Not for the sale itself - there is no federal requirement. Some clerks ask for a ZIP code to fill a form field; anything works. An eSIM has no counter step at all.
Will my US eSIM work in Tijuana?
No. A US plan covers the United States only, and Mexico is a separate destination with a separate plan. This matters more in San Diego than anywhere else in the country, because the crossing at San Ysidro is a short trolley ride from downtown and thousands of visitors make the trip. If you are going over for the day, either buy a Mexico plan as well or plan to be offline until you are back.
